Pixelmon Mod - Bug tracker

NPC Advanced AI fix completed for upcoming version

Ticket description:
NPC advanced AI does not know what to do when you're in fly state, dig state, or dive state most of the time. It will switch out the turn you're invincible.

Steps to reproduce:
1. Have an NPC with a team of 6
2. Have a fast Pokemon with fly
3. Use fly 1st turn >> Opponent will use a move and miss >> Opponent will switch out >> Your fly will hit
4. Use fly again >> Opponent will use a move and miss >> Opponent will switch out >> Your fly will hit

It does not always happen, but the switches seem to be random. It's not switching to a Pokemon that resists the attack either.

Another case is when you're in fly state, dig state or dive state, the NPC Advanced AI won't know your type and will just use their most powerful move. For example when I fly using Flygon:

1. Flygon uses fly
2. Zapdos will use discharge
3. Flygon's fly hits
4. Zapdos uses thunderbolt on flygon

Comments

#16273 Posted by SnowBlitzz » 12 May 2017 11:06

Apologies. Correction on the number 2 of the 2nd part.

1. Flygon uses fly
2. Zapdos will use HEAT WAVE*
3. Flygon's fly hits
4. Zapdos uses thunderbolt on flygon

Ticket details

  • Ticket ID: 12074
  • Project: Pixelmon Mod
  • Status: Fix completed for upcoming version
  • Component: (unknown)
  • Project version: (unknown)
  • Priority: Normal
  • Severity: Normal
  • Forge/Sponge: (unknown)
  • What else would be useful to know?: (unknown)
  • Assigned to: Some Body
  • Reported by: SnowBlitzz (Send PM)
  • Reporter's tickets: (List all tickets)
  • Reported on: 12 May 2017 10:35
  • Ticket last visited by: Some Body on 16 May 2017 07:26
JOIN THE TEAM